In 1930 Angus Brittain was a widower. Living with him were his children: Margaret, 20; Doyle, 14; Norris E., 6; and William T., 2.
NOTE: His middle name is given as Griffin on both his WW I and WW II Draft Registration Cards. In 1942 he was 63 years old, 5'-9" tall, 132 lbs., blue eyes, gray hair, ruddy complexion.

Ark-La-Tex Deaths
Augus [sic] G. Brittain
CENTER, Tex. — Funeral services for Angus Gus Brittain, 93, were held at 10 a.m. today in the Bartle Funeral Home with the Rev. P. E. Walton officiating. Burial was in the Patroon Cemetery.
Mr. Brittain died Tuesday.
Survivors include his wife; four sons, Jewel Brittain of Center, Doyle Brittain of Sandi, Norris Brittain of Ogden, Utah and Billy Brittain of Pasadena; three stepsons, Thurman Dean, Roy Porter and Preston Porter, all of Pasadena; two daughters, Mrs. Margaret Leiderbrand of Alamogorde [sic], N. M., and Mrs. Mollie Braden of Atlanta, Ga.; two stepdaughters, Mrs. Elizabeth Sanford of Joaquin and Mrs. Iris Dean of Washington; 28 grandchildren and 13 great-grandchildren.
—The Shreveport Journal (Shreveport, Louisiana), Friday, March 16, 1973, p. 8C.
